A B C D E F G H I J K L M N O P Q R S T U V W X Z 

P

ParseException - Exception in org.xbrlapi.xpointer
This exception is thrown when parse errors are encountered.
ParseException(Token, int[][], String[]) - Constructor for exception org.xbrlapi.xpointer.ParseException
This constructor is used by the method "generateParseException" in the generated parser.
ParseException() - Constructor for exception org.xbrlapi.xpointer.ParseException
The following constructors are for use by you for whatever purpose you can think of.
ParseException(String) - Constructor for exception org.xbrlapi.xpointer.ParseException
Constructor with message.
PartialLoadingTestCase - Class in org.xbrlapi.loader.tests
Test the loader handling of partial loading situations.
PartialLoadingTestCase() - Constructor for class org.xbrlapi.loader.tests.PartialLoadingTestCase
 
Pavel2TestCase - Class in org.xbrlapi.data.bdbxml.examples.tests
 
Pavel2TestCase() - Constructor for class org.xbrlapi.data.bdbxml.examples.tests.Pavel2TestCase
 
PavelTestCase - Class in org.xbrlapi.data.bdbxml.examples.tests
Tests label retrieval
PavelTestCase() - Constructor for class org.xbrlapi.data.bdbxml.examples.tests.PavelTestCase
 
Period - Interface in org.xbrlapi
 
PeriodAspect - Class in org.xbrlapi.aspects
Period aspect details
PeriodAspect(Domain) - Constructor for class org.xbrlapi.aspects.PeriodAspect
 
PeriodAspectTestCase - Class in org.xbrlapi.aspects.tests
 
PeriodAspectTestCase() - Constructor for class org.xbrlapi.aspects.tests.PeriodAspectTestCase
 
PeriodAspectValue - Class in org.xbrlapi.aspects
 
PeriodAspectValue() - Constructor for class org.xbrlapi.aspects.PeriodAspectValue
Missing aspect value constructor - relevant for tuples and nil facts.
PeriodAspectValue(Period) - Constructor for class org.xbrlapi.aspects.PeriodAspectValue
 
PeriodDomain - Class in org.xbrlapi.aspects
 
PeriodDomain(Store) - Constructor for class org.xbrlapi.aspects.PeriodDomain
 
PeriodEndLabelRole - Static variable in class org.xbrlapi.utilities.Constants
 
PeriodImpl - Class in org.xbrlapi.impl
Implementation of context period fragments for instants and durations.
PeriodImpl() - Constructor for class org.xbrlapi.impl.PeriodImpl
 
PeriodLabeller - Class in org.xbrlapi.aspects
A labeller for the period aspect.
PeriodLabeller(Aspect) - Constructor for class org.xbrlapi.aspects.PeriodLabeller
 
PeriodLabellerNaive - Class in org.xbrlapi.aspects
A labeller for the period aspect.
PeriodLabellerNaive(Aspect) - Constructor for class org.xbrlapi.aspects.PeriodLabellerNaive
 
PeriodLabellerQuarters - Class in org.xbrlapi.aspects
A labeller for the period aspect that buckets up period values based on the quarter that they end in or occur in.
PeriodLabellerQuarters(Aspect) - Constructor for class org.xbrlapi.aspects.PeriodLabellerQuarters
 
PeriodStartLabelRole - Static variable in class org.xbrlapi.utilities.Constants
 
PeriodTestCase - Class in org.xbrlapi.fragment.tests
Tests the implementation of the org.xbrlapi.Period interface.
PeriodTestCase() - Constructor for class org.xbrlapi.fragment.tests.PeriodTestCase
 
persist(XML) - Method in class org.xbrlapi.data.bdbxml.StoreImpl
 
persist(XML) - Method in class org.xbrlapi.data.dom.StoreImpl
 
persist(XML) - Method in class org.xbrlapi.data.exist.embedded.StoreImpl
Add a fragment to the DTS.
persist(XML) - Method in class org.xbrlapi.data.exist.StoreImpl
Add a fragment to the DTS.
persist(XML) - Method in interface org.xbrlapi.data.Store
Store a fragment.
PersistAllRelationshipsInStore - Class in org.xbrlapi.data.bdbxml.examples.utilities
Persists all of the relationships in the data store.
PersistAllRelationshipsInStore(String[]) - Constructor for class org.xbrlapi.data.bdbxml.examples.utilities.PersistAllRelationshipsInStore
 
PersistedNetworksTestCase - Class in org.xbrlapi.relationships.tests
 
PersistedNetworksTestCase() - Constructor for class org.xbrlapi.relationships.tests.PersistedNetworksTestCase
 
PersistedRelationshipErrorsTestCase - Class in org.xbrlapi.relationships.tests
 
PersistedRelationshipErrorsTestCase() - Constructor for class org.xbrlapi.relationships.tests.PersistedRelationshipErrorsTestCase
 
PersistedRelationshipLoadingTestCase - Class in org.xbrlapi.relationships.tests
 
PersistedRelationshipLoadingTestCase() - Constructor for class org.xbrlapi.relationships.tests.PersistedRelationshipLoadingTestCase
 
persistLoaderState(Map<URI, String>) - Method in class org.xbrlapi.data.BaseStoreImpl
 
persistLoaderState(Map<URI, String>) - Method in interface org.xbrlapi.data.Store
Stores the state of the document discovery process.
PersistRelationshipsInSpecifiedDocument - Class in org.xbrlapi.data.bdbxml.examples.utilities
Persists all of the relationships defined by arcs in the specified document.
PersistRelationshipsInSpecifiedDocument(String[]) - Constructor for class org.xbrlapi.data.bdbxml.examples.utilities.PersistRelationshipsInSpecifiedDocument
 
persistStub(URI, String) - Method in class org.xbrlapi.data.BaseStoreImpl
 
persistStub(URI, String) - Method in interface org.xbrlapi.data.Store
 
Pointer() - Method in class org.xbrlapi.xpointer.PointerGrammar
 
PointerGrammar - Class in org.xbrlapi.xpointer
DO NOT EDIT THIS FILE.
PointerGrammar(InputStream) - Constructor for class org.xbrlapi.xpointer.PointerGrammar
Constructor with InputStream.
PointerGrammar(InputStream, String) - Constructor for class org.xbrlapi.xpointer.PointerGrammar
Constructor with InputStream and supplied encoding
PointerGrammar(Reader) - Constructor for class org.xbrlapi.xpointer.PointerGrammar
Constructor.
PointerGrammar(PointerGrammarTokenManager) - Constructor for class org.xbrlapi.xpointer.PointerGrammar
Constructor with generated Token Manager.
PointerGrammarConstants - Interface in org.xbrlapi.xpointer
Token literal values and constants.
PointerGrammarTestCase - Class in org.xbrlapi.xpointer.tests
 
PointerGrammarTestCase() - Constructor for class org.xbrlapi.xpointer.tests.PointerGrammarTestCase
 
PointerGrammarTokenManager - Class in org.xbrlapi.xpointer
Token Manager.
PointerGrammarTokenManager(SimpleCharStream) - Constructor for class org.xbrlapi.xpointer.PointerGrammarTokenManager
Constructor.
PointerGrammarTokenManager(SimpleCharStream, int) - Constructor for class org.xbrlapi.xpointer.PointerGrammarTokenManager
Constructor.
PointerPart - Interface in org.xbrlapi.xpointer
Defines the functionality associated with a single scheme component of an XPointer expression.
PointerPartImpl - Class in org.xbrlapi.xpointer
 
PointerPartImpl() - Constructor for class org.xbrlapi.xpointer.PointerPartImpl
Create an uninitialised pointer part.
PointerScheme() - Method in class org.xbrlapi.xpointer.PointerGrammar
 
PositiveLabelRole - Static variable in class org.xbrlapi.utilities.Constants
 
PositiveTerseLabelRole - Static variable in class org.xbrlapi.utilities.Constants
 
PositiveVerboseLabelRole - Static variable in class org.xbrlapi.utilities.Constants
 
PresentationArcrole - Static variable in class org.xbrlapi.utilities.Constants
 
PresentationGuidanceLabelRole - Static variable in class org.xbrlapi.utilities.Constants
 
PresentationLinkbaseReferenceRole - Static variable in class org.xbrlapi.utilities.Constants
 
PresentationReferenceRole - Static variable in class org.xbrlapi.utilities.Constants
 
printMessages() - Method in class org.xbrlapi.xlink.Validator
Print the errors and warnings to System out
printStackTrace() - Method in exception org.xbrlapi.utilities.XBRLException
 
printStackTrace(PrintStream) - Method in exception org.xbrlapi.utilities.XBRLException
 
printStackTrace(PrintWriter) - Method in exception org.xbrlapi.utilities.XBRLException
 
printStackTrace() - Method in exception org.xbrlapi.xlink.XLinkException
 
printStackTrace(PrintStream) - Method in exception org.xbrlapi.xlink.XLinkException
 
printStackTrace(PrintWriter) - Method in exception org.xbrlapi.xlink.XLinkException
 
printStackTrace() - Method in exception org.xbrlapi.xmlbase.XMLBaseException
 
printStackTrace(PrintStream) - Method in exception org.xbrlapi.xmlbase.XMLBaseException
 
printStackTrace(PrintWriter) - Method in exception org.xbrlapi.xmlbase.XMLBaseException
 
processFragment(Fragment, Attributes) - Method in class org.xbrlapi.sax.identifiers.BaseIdentifier
Performs the following operations on the fragment: Sets its fragment index Determines if the fragment as an ID attribute and if so, appends an ID ( @see org.xbrlapi.Fragment#appendID(String) ) and sets the ID in the element state. Adds the fragment ( @see org.xbrlapi.loader.Loader#add(org.xbrlapi.Fragment,org.xbrlapi.xlink.ElementState) ) Override this base implementation if an ID of the fragment root element can be expressed by an attribute other than "id".
processFragment(Fragment, Attributes) - Method in interface org.xbrlapi.sax.identifiers.Identifier
Set up the fragment index, handle ID metadata for the fragment and add it to the loader.
processingInstruction(String, String) - Method in class org.xbrlapi.sax.ContentHandlerImpl
Copy across processing instructions to the DTSImpl
processingInstruction(String, String) - Method in class org.xbrlapi.sax.DTDHandler.tests.framework.Handler
Copy across processing instructions to the DTSImpl
purge(URI) - Method in interface org.xbrlapi.cache.Cache
Delete a resource from the cache.
purge(URI) - Method in class org.xbrlapi.cache.CacheImpl
 
PurgeIdenticalDocuments - Class in org.xbrlapi.data.bdbxml.examples.utilities
Purges and then reloads any documents where there are multiple versions of them in the data store.
PurgeIdenticalDocuments(String[]) - Constructor for class org.xbrlapi.data.bdbxml.examples.utilities.PurgeIdenticalDocuments
 
putGrammar(Grammar) - Method in class org.xbrlapi.utilities.XBRLAPIGrammarPoolImpl
 
A B C D E F G H I J K L M N O P Q R S T U V W X Z